Your garden centre will be able to sell you packets of cut flower food which will help keep your gerbera from wilting. Mix the flower food with 1 litre of warm water (not hot). Cut the bottom of the stem at an angle of 45 degrees using a sterile pair of scissors and place in the water in the vase.

Web18 mrt. 2024 · Underwatering and excessive heat are the main reasons for hydrangea wilt. To fix drooping leaves, water hydrangeas as soon as the soil is 1 inch dry and provide at least 4 to 6 hours of shade. Also, avoid overwatering and make sure that there is good air exchange around the hydrangea to avoid wilting or drooping of the leaves. However, there can be fungus-related issues troubling your Impatiens, such as mildew, verticillium wilt. irori hostel and kitchenWeb9 aug. 2024 · To sterilize garden soil: Mix equal parts of garden soil and peat moss or vermiculite; if you don't, the soil becomes too hard after it's baked. Moisten the soil mixture and spread it in a large baking pan. Heat the soil mixture for one hour in a 180- to 200-degree Fahrenheit oven.
